Adopting a Proactive Approach to Client Expenses with Spend Management

As an accounting professional, you might consider expense management and spend management interchangeable words. The ideas do overlap in some ways. However, the two concepts have a distinct difference.

Expense management focuses on the money employees spend on behalf of their company, including travel, events, meals, and more.

Spend management represents a holistic approach to handling all cash flow—whether it’s for meals, online ads, software, or payments to vendors. It provides a proactive path for accounting firms to help their clients track, analyze, and control spend.

Welcome to the next evolution of addressing expenses, one that follows the principles of spend management.
